Chivu: ‘Verona saved me, Martinez problem for the remainder of his life’

Inter head coach Cristian Chivu has opened up about his return to Verona, the place he as soon as suffered a career-threatening head harm, and has spoken in regards to the return of Josep Martinez to the matchday squad, simply 4 days after he was concerned in a automobile accident that resulted within the dying of an 81-year-old man close to the membership’s coaching floor.

Chivu mentioned these matters, in addition to his facet’s latest outcomes and his staff choice, forward of the Serie A match between Verona and Inter on the Bentegodi on Sunday afternoon.

Chivu: ‘I’ve misplaced and gained so much in Verona’

Inter might convey themselves inside a degree of the lead of the Serie A desk with a victory over Verona on Sunday after the 3-0 victory over Fiorentina earlier this week.

Regardless of the Fiorentina win, Chivu believes that Inter nonetheless have loads of room to enhance.

“The response wasn’t taken as a right. Now we have to maintain doing what we have now been doing, and add a little bit extra. It’s in our DNA to do higher,” he earlier than kick-off towards Verona.

Chivu has loads of belief in Ange-Yoan Bonny and Petar Sucic, who’re once more on Sunday.

“They’re simply pretty much as good as Luis Henrique, Diouf, Pio Esposito, even when the Frenchman hasn’t had a lot of an opportunity however his time will come,” Chivu stated. “I’ve a bunch of incredible gamers, who imagine on this staff and in our dream.”

Verona is a significant metropolis for Chivu, who as soon as fractured his cranium after a stunning conflict of heads with Chievo striker Sergio Pellissier. Chivu required surgical procedure after elements of his cranium had caved in, and as soon as he returned to enjoying, all the time wore a protecting helmet for the remainder of his profession.

“Loads of time has handed. It was a rebirth for me right here. I misplaced, but in addition gained so much that day. I realised that a very powerful issues in life should not profitable or shedding, however quite, to understand a profession that doesn’t final for lengthy.

“I’m comfortable, I got here again right here with Parma final yr, however I don’t take into consideration what occurred to me, however in regards to the metropolis, which gave a lot to me. They saved my life in that hospital and I nonetheless thank them in any case these years. Verona is a incredible place.”

And, on Josep Martinez, who’s within the matchday squad regardless of being concerned in a traumatic incident earlier this week, Chivu stated:“We’re considering of him and serving to him as a membership, however we’re additionally occupied with the household of the deceased.

“We’ve acquired to take care of him and take into consideration the difficulties he may have for the remainder of his life. We are going to stand shut by him, the togetherness of the group can be essential.”
